When starting a collection d’œuvre d’art, it is important to approach the process with an open mind and a willingness to explore different styles, mediums, and artists. A diverse collection can offer a well-rounded view of the art world and provide you with a richer and more fulfilling experience as a collector.

One approach to building a collection is to focus on a particular genre, style, or time period that speaks to you personally. By honing in on a specific area of interest, you can develop a cohesive and focused collection that reflects your unique tastes and preferences. For example, you may choose to collect contemporary art, traditional paintings, photography, sculpture, or works by a specific artist or movement.

Another approach is to collect art based on emotion or intuition. Let your heart guide you as you explore galleries, exhibitions, and online platforms in search of pieces that resonate with you on a deep emotional level. Trust your instincts and allow your passion for art to drive your collection.
